Financial Analysis
The numbers behind Rainbow Restoration
The disaster restoration industry benefits from recession-resistant demand drivers, as water damage, fire incidents, and mold issues require immediate professional intervention regardless of economic conditions. Insurance partnerships provide stable revenue streams, while climate change trends potentially increase severe weather events driving service demand.
Rainbow's reported gross revenue of $1,033,737 exceeds the sub-sector average of $910,979, suggesting strong operational performance within the system. FDD Item 7
Initial investment range
Per FDD Item 7, total initial investment ranges from $169,336 to $325,900. The midpoint $247,618 is what most franchisees report at signing — financing typically reduces cash-at-close by 80–90%.
